Welcome to the front desk at Bramleigh & Co! One thing you'll use a lot: the secure interview room behind reception, where candidate chats and sensitive meetings happen. Keep it locked whenever it's empty, and tidy the table between sessions. To let interviewers in, use the door code shown below.

door code, yagap-bahof: bdg-O-05

## Further Reading

The Quillbase SQL lint rules run in CI on every file under /sql. Most failures come from missing schema prefixes or disallowed SELECT *. Rules are versioned quarterly; exceptions require a lint-waiver annotation. The complete rule catalog and waiver process are documented on the internal page below.

wiki page, yaguf-bawig: https://jira.norvacorp.internal/browse/display/view/b5a061abb09d

Chalkline is the timetable solver used by the Ardenfield school district pilot: it takes room capacities, teacher availability, and subject constraints, then runs a CP-SAT pass followed by a local-search repair phase. As a reviewer, pay close attention to the constraint-weight changes in solver/weights.py—small edits there can silently break hard constraints. Release artifacts are built by the Slateworks pipeline and must be signed before publication to the district mirror. Reviewers verify signatures using the key below.

signing key of hahag-tahag = bky4_v18e